SLIPS ON ROADS
SCENIC HIGHWAY CLOSED OTHER ROUTES STILL OPEN The vain over the past few days has started to have its effect on some roads in the district, and the following report on conditions has been made available by tire resident A.A. patrol, Mr. E. W. Cook:— Gisborne-Napier, via Tiniroto. —Open. Gisborne-Napier, via Morere. —Open; one or two small slips on Wharernta Hill.
Gisborne-Opotiki, via Waioeka. Open. Tra(lord’s Hill is reported to be in a bad state, but traffic is getting through. Gisborne-Opotiki, via East Cape.---Closed for three davs at least. Ru’d closed by slip at Oruatiti Bluff, a miles on the Te Araroa side of Waihau Bay.
